Matlab里四个函数:Floor, Ceil, Fix, Round

本文详细介绍了数值处理中四种常见的舍入方法:floor(向下取整)、ceil(向上取整)、fix(向零取整)及round(四舍五入)。通过实例展示了每种方法的应用效果,并解释了对于复数这些操作是如何独立作用于实部和虚部。
摘要由CSDN通过智能技术生成
转自:http://blog.mcuol.com/User/nielixian/Article/7946_1.htm

floor:朝负无穷方向舍入
B = floor(A) rounds the elements of A to the nearest integers less than or equal to A.
ceil:朝正无穷方向舍入
B = ceil(A) rounds the elements of A to the nearest integers greater than or equal to A.
fix:朝零方向舍入
B = fix(A) rounds the elements of A toward zero, resulting in an array of integers.
round:四舍五入
B = round(A) rounds the elements of X to the nearest integers.  
norm:求矩阵或向量的泛数
             x = [1 2 3 4 5 6];
             norm(x) = 9.5394
Example:
a=         [-0.9,    -2.1,    -0.4,    0.3,    0.8,    1.1,    2.7,    -1.2+2.9i];

floor(a)=[ -1,      -3,      -1,      0,      0,      1,      2,       -2+2i]

ceil(a)= [ 0,       -2,       0,      1,      1,      2,      3,       -1+3i]

fix(a)=    [ 0,       -2,       0,      0,      0,      1,      2,       -1+2i]

round(a)=[-1,       -2,       0,      0,      1,      1,      3,       -1+3i]

注:For complex X, for all the four fuctions the imaginary and real parts are rounded independently.
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值